  • Anti-fatigue Function of Schizophyllum commune in Mice

    HAO Rui-fang; LI Rong-chun Institute of Edible Fungi; Yunnan Agricultural University; Kunming; Yunnan 650201; China

    【英文摘要】 Levels of liver and muscle glycogen, blood urea nitrogen (BUN), blood lactic acid (LD), succinate dehydrogenase (SDH) and lactate dehydrogenase (LDH) were determined in mice that were fed diets containing either Schizophyllum commune fruit body powder or submerged cultures of the fungus. Liver glycogen levels, and SDH and LDH levels in the serum of mice fed diets containing mushroom fruit bodies or submerged culture material were significantly higher (P<0.01) compared with control mice fed basal feed only. Muscle glycogen levels were also significantly higher (P<0.01) in mice fed fruit body-containing diets than in control mice. Compared with controls, LD elimination rates were higher, and increases in BUN were significantly lower (P<0.01), in mice fed diets containing either mushroom fruit bodies or submerged culture material. These data indicate a clear anti-fatigue function for S. commune.

    【英文关键词】 Schizophyllum commune; Anti-fatigue; Glycogen; Succinate dehydrogenase; Lactic dehydrogenase; Urea nitrogen; Lactic acid
